Abstract :The aim of this study was to investigate the effect of the genre-based writing method in distance education courses. In this study, where action research was chosen as a research method, the researcher examined the use of the genre-based writing method in writing lessons of 8 foreign students at the B2 level who took a Turkish course over a 7-week period. For the data collection tools; the lessons’ video-recordings (observation), semi-structured interviews (interview) and the writings of the participants (document analysis) were examined. Thematic analysis was used in this study with both deductive and inductive processes. As a result, it was observed that genre-based writing method increased students\' writing skills considerably in distance Turkish writing lessons. Another major finding was that the participants’ characteristics affected their success. However, in some sub-headings of this study, because of distance education’s nature, the implementation of the genre-based writing method did not show the expected successes. Finally, large-scale experimental studies containing genre-based writing method implementation and studies on self-regulation strategies in online writing lessons were suggested.Keywords : Çevrimiçi öğrenme, Tür temelli yazma, Uzaktan eğitim, Yazma eğitimi
